** OKLAHOMA. 1120, KEOR Catoosa/Sperry/Tulsa observations: on the air Oct 26 at 1857 UT with banda music, 1900 segué with no ID. We have never heard them ID in latest reactivation. 1917 recheck off the air, or maybe carrier is still on; hard to tell on caradio. 1939 on receiver with BFO, carrier is definitely off. Nothing heard around 1300 or 1700 UT Oct 27.

This correlates with Bruce Winkelman`s notes at local range in Tulsa: 
``Just tuned past 1120 and there is Spanish language vocal music from presumed KEOR-1120! 1247Z 26OCT12. 1305-1335Z 26OCT12 Spanish language vocal music, with no announcements or other identifying "talk" between selections. Quick check of 1120 this morning 1232-1240Z 27OCT12 shows no OC from presumed KEOR, only a faint KMOX`` (Glenn Hauser, Enid, DX LISTENING DIGEST)

** OKLAHOMA. 1120, Oct 28 at 1950 UT, KEOR Catoosa/Sperry/Tulsa is back on with continuous Mexican music, well audible via caradio on another expedition north of Enid to Squirrel Haven; however, asphalt portions of US 81/64/60 where we are simultaneously northbound, westbound and eastbound, produce heavy tire static, while concrete portions much less so. I stop at a pulloff by a celltower with no visible means of electrical support; powerlines are poler, but on other side of highway. Do these things run on batteries or own generators even when powerlines are handy? At least they put out no RFI on MW. 

During all this recent KEOR reactivity, tho I have not listened for hours at a time straight, I have never caught any announcement, let alone a slogan, or legal ID, so I make sure to listen at the next hourtop, 1959: No, just segué to more music. Seems they don`t think they need to ID legally. Still on at 2019 with music introducing itself as cumbia! (Glenn Hauser, O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)

** OKLAHOMA. 1120, Oct 29 at 1930 UT, KEOR is not on the air. Wayne Heinen, editor of the NRC AM Log, says, ``A look at the Silent STA filing at the FCC says that the reason the station went silent back in June was "technical". Maybe they replace a part or two, run a few tests and then shut it off and try to find another way to fix it``.

Maybe, but as I said before, if it was ever on the air this past June, we missed it completely, and/or it was very brief; as it had also been off the air for many months before that (Glenn Hauser, O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)

** OKLAHOMA. 1430, Oct 28 at 2006 UT, near Squirrel Haven about 10 miles north of Enid, I am parked and bandscanning on the caradio. I especially want a definite log of nearby KALV, which is hard to hear dentro-Enid due to its null protecting KTBZ Tulsa. Out here we are just far enough away from the null to hear it weakly atop KTBZ and making a SAH of about 8 Hz. ``Your host for Northwestern Rangers [a silly ballteam] in Alva, 1430 AM stereo, KALV`` (Glenn Hauser, O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)

** U S A. 529, Oct 31 at 0538, LYQ beacon ID repeated in Morse, copiable aside Cuba 530. Capt. David Frantz, Chief Pilot of ATC, notified me that this had just been reactivated as backup to their ILS due to night flights. It`s at the WWRB site, Manchester TN, and reports are welcome via the WWRB website (Glenn Hauser, OK, WORLD OF RADIO 1641, DX LISTENING DIGEST)

** U S A. 940, Sat Oct 27 at 1236 UT from SW/NE, ``Band of Gold`` nostalgia song, then ``Tnx for the Memories`` but not by Bob Hope, plug 515-964-8947 to order CDs, ``Music & Memories show on your favorite radio station`` from the 1940s. This leads to only one:
http://tunein.com/radio/options/Music-and-Memories-p230604/
Praise 940 in Des Moines IA, Saturdays at 7-8 am [CT], which fits, i.e. KPSZ, which NRC AM Log classifies as REL:AC but at the moment is really NOS if not REL:NOS. Apparently it`s the ONLY station carrying this show, as also seems local with 515 AC. 

Remember when 940 Des Moines was KIOA? That perfect call ended 11/18/1996 when it became KTXK; and then from 09/03/2002 KPSZ. 10 kW day pattern from 1230 UT in Oct has a broad major lobe centered on 260 degrees, but still plenty toward Enid, all per FCC AM Query (Glenn Hauser, O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)

UNIDENTIFIED. 930, Nov 1 at 0529 UT, something is occupying the null of Spanish WKY OKC: promo for Rush at 9 am, then temps but no local refs caught; and into Yahoo Sportsradio.com, slogan something like ``Sportstalk 930``. A strange combination, both Rush and YSR? Or maybe the Rush promo was for a sibling station. 9 am means MST or PDT for live airing, but there are no such 930 stations on the Rush affiliate list. 

The only 930 stations on the YSR affiliate list:
Jacksonville FL WFXJ-AM 930 AM
Battle Creek MI WBCK-AM 930 AM
Jackson MS      WSFZ-AM 930 AM
Greenville NC   WDLX-AM 930 AM
None of these have favorable night patterns for us, but Jackson MS is closest. WSFZ website says it`s Super Sport 930. But Rush couldn`t be on at 9 am in that market, not starting until 11 am CT (Glenn Hauser, O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)
